New Delhi [India], June 20: As major global automakers race to strengthen their presence in the electric vehicle (EV) market, interest among Arab consumers continues to grow — particularly in evaluating which models are best suited to regional conditions.

In this context, Mohammed Fahad, a prominent Saudi automotive expert and content creator specializing in EVs, has released his list of the top five electric vehicles for 2025. The selection is based on hands-on test drives and in-depth technical analysis.

Fahad, known for his honest reviews and extensive experience gained from traveling the world and attending major global auto exhibitions, selected these models based on key criteria: performance, range, reliability, comfort, and technology.

1. Tesla Model 3 Highland

Range: Up to 595 km | 0–100 km/h: 4.6 seconds

·       Tesla's iconic Model 3 received a major facelift in the 2025 "Highland" version.

·       Mohammed Fahad recommends it as the ideal entry point into the EV world, offering a unique balance of performance, advanced technology, and user-friendliness.

Key highlights:

·       Upgraded interior screen

·       Improved build quality

·       Advanced voice control

·       Access to Tesla’s integrated Supercharger network

Mohammed: “Tesla is still the benchmark, and the Model 3 Highland offers the best value for money in its class.”

2. Hyundai Ioniq 6

Range: Up to 614 km | 0–100 km/h: 5.1 seconds

·       Hyundai’s electric sedan made a strong impression with its sleek, aerodynamic design and sophisticated cabin.

·       Fahad calls it a “hidden gem” in the EV market, particularly for those seeking comfort and economy.

Standout features:

·       Spacious and comfortable interior

·       Ultra-fast 800V charging system

·       Ventilated and heated seats

·       Wireless Android Auto & Apple CarPlay

Mohammed: “The Ioniq 6 excels in comfort and long-distance stability — it was one of the biggest surprises for me.”

3. BYD Seal

Range: Up to 570 km | 0–100 km/h: 3.8 seconds

·       From Chinese manufacturing giant BYD, the Seal combines a sporty design with performance that rivals much more expensive models.

·       Fahad strongly recommends it, especially after his test drive in China. He considers it the best-value Chinese EV currently available.

Why it stands out:

·       Sports car-level performance at a mid-range price

·       Safe and long-lasting Blade Battery

·       Premium, stylish interior

·       Intelligent driving tech

Mohammed: “The BYD Seal shattered the outdated image of Chinese cars — this one competes with the elite.”

4. Kia EV9

Range: Up to 541 km | Seating: 6 or 7 passengers

·       For families and SUV lovers, the EV9 stands out as Kia’s first full-size all-electric SUV.

·       Fahad describes it as the perfect blend of space, power, and smart tech.

Key highlights:

·       Massive panoramic interior screen

·       Three rows of seats

·       Semi-autonomous driving system

·       Bold and futuristic exterior design

Mohammed: “The EV9 fills a long-empty gap in the market... I believe it’ll be one of Kia’s biggest hits.”

5. Volvo EX30

Range: Up to 480 km | Class: Compact SUV

·       The Volvo EX30 is one of the most anticipated EVs of the year — particularly for fans of Scandinavian safety and practical European design.

·       Mohammed recommends it as the perfect choice for urban drivers who want something smart, compact, and sustainable.

Why it’s worth it:

·       Clean, minimalist luxury design

·       Industry-leading safety systems

·       Outstanding user interface on the central screen

·       Eco-friendly and sustainable materials

Mohammed: “The EX30 proves a car doesn’t need to be big to be great.”

Final Word from Mohammed Fahad:

“This list is not ranked — these are top choices depending on category and usage. My advice: don’t buy the most powerful specs, buy what suits your lifestyle.”

Mohammed emphasizes that the Arab EV market still requires more awareness and stronger infrastructure to truly thrive. He stresses the importance of supporting the transition to cleaner, smarter mobility across the region.
